Role Overview

As the Director of Human Resources, you will serve as a key member of the leadership team, responsible for architecting a people-first HR function that supports High Fidelity’s rapid growth and evolving business needs. This is a highly visible role, entrusted with developing and executing comprehensive HR strategies across the entire employee life cycle, from attracting and nurturing top talent to fostering a culture of inclusion, engagement, and high performance. You will champion our values while navigating the unique challenges of a fast-paced, highly regulated industry.

Key Responsibilities

  • Strategic Leadership: Design, implement, and continuously refine HR strategies, policies, and programs that align with business objectives and reinforce our company values of integrity, inclusivity, and innovation.
  • Talent Acquisition & Onboarding: Lead end-to-end recruitment efforts, partnering with hiring managers to identify current and future staffing needs, develop compelling employer branding initiatives, and deliver a seamless onboarding experience for new hires.
  • Employee Engagement & Retention: Build and sustain high employee morale by developing programs that support recognition, well-being, professional growth, and strong internal communication. Analyze engagement data to drive improvements and enhance retention.
  • Performance Management: Oversee the design and execution of performance review processes, goal setting, and feedback systems to cultivate a high-performing, accountable workforce. Coach managers in talent development and succession planning.
  • Organizational Development: Identify skill gaps and lead initiatives around learning and development, leadership training, and organizational design to support current and future business needs.
  • Compliance & Risk Management: Ensure company-wide compliance with all Missouri state cannabis regulations, labor and employment laws, and workplace safety standards. Maintain up-to-date knowledge of relevant legislation and proactively address any compliance risks.
  • Employee Relations: Serve as a trusted advisor to employees and leadership, addressing workplace concerns with empathy, fairness, and a solutions-oriented approach. Manage investigations, conflict resolution, and disciplinary processes as necessary.
  • Diversity, Equity & Inclusion: Champion DEI initiatives, fostering an environment where every team member can thrive. Develop strategies to attract, retain, and advance a diverse workforce.
  • HR Operations & Analytics: Oversee HR systems, reporting, and analytics to inform data-driven decision-making. Ensure accurate record-keeping and optimize HR workflows for efficiency and effectiveness.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or related field; Master’s degree or relevant certification (e.g., SHRM-CP/SCP, PHR/SPHR) strongly preferred.
  • Minimum 7 years of progressive HR experience, including at least 3 years in a leadership or strategic HR management role, ideally within a regulated industry.
  • Comprehensive knowledge of HR best practices, current employment laws, and regulatory compliance requirements- Missouri state experience a plus.
  • Demonstrated expertise in talent acquisition, employee engagement, performance management, and organizational development.
  • Exceptional interpersonal and communication skills; proven ability to build trust and influence at all levels of the organization.
  • Strong analytical, problem-solving, and decision-making abilities, with a data-driven approach to continuous improvement.
  • Passion for fostering a diverse, equitable, and inclusive workplace culture.
  • Experience in the cannabis industry or other highly regulated sectors is an asset but not required.
